Subject: Handover — orders soft-delete work

Welcome aboard. Short version: the Cindermill orders table uses soft deletes via `deleted_at`. Never hard-delete; reporting and the Thornwick reconciliation job both depend on tombstones. The purge job runs Sundays and only touches rows flagged over two years. Watch migration 88 — it backfills deleted_at and is slow on the big shards. Releases go out Tuesdays; you sign them yourself from now on. Your deploy signing key is the following.

signing key of bagap-yawep = bky13_TbfT6ZMUoGJo2

Step 3: Swap in the Larchmont address autocomplete widget

Replace the legacy typeahead with the Larchmont widget on checkout and account pages. The old component stays mounted but hidden until we confirm parity; kill it next sprint. Suggestions now come from the regional index, so expect different ordering in tests — update snapshots accordingly. Widget fails closed to a plain text field. Initialize the widget with the configuration below.

settings of fafog-haduf:
ZORIX_PIN=4648
ZORIX_METRICS_HOST=metrics.zorix.paliqsys.corp
ZORIX_LOG_LEVEL=info
ZORIX_TENANT=druix

## Support

Nightcart is our scheduler for nightly data backfills — it queues jobs after the warehouse snapshot lands and retries failures up to three times. From a security angle, the bits you'll care about: jobs run under scoped service accounts, credentials rotate weekly, and all job definitions live in the audited config repo. Nothing runs ad hoc without a signed-off change. Audit logs are retained for a year. Questions about access scopes or the review trail go to the team at the address below.

alerts address for kajog-tadup: druox@plorvanet.internal

Ticket: PRAT-412. The Chattermill service on staging floods Logvane with unsampled debug lines — ~40k/min. Root cause: sampling env vars never copied from prod. Fix: add LOG_SAMPLE_RATE=0.05 and LOG_SINK_REGION to staging .env, restart the collector. The sink also needs its write credential, so append the Logvane write token on the line after this one.

sealed setting: VAULT_KEY20=c8ea1e419912889df6b4